Donation-receipt mailer (ThanksEngine) — release notes

ThanksEngine generates and sends tax receipts for Brightacre Foundation donors. Releases go out Tuesdays only. Templates are versioned; never hotfix production HTML directly. Smoke test: trigger a sandbox donation, confirm receipt renders with correct totals. The signing keystore locks itself after each release cycle. Before cutting a release, unlock it with the recovery passphrase below.

strongbox words: prawyn-fenmir

**Vendor note: Inkmill markdown pipeline**

Rendering for Parchway docs is outsourced to Inkmill under an annual contract, renewing each March. They handle sanitization and PDF export; we own the upload queue. SLA: 4-hour response on rendering failures. Escalate only after two failed retries. Their support desk is reachable at the address below.

billing contact of hahaf-baguf = zorael.tammir.jorius@sivrelhq.internal

Hey team — quick Driftbin recovery steps. When a customer's cold storage bucket gets archived early, their account can end up half-locked. Restore the bucket from the Glacierhold tier first, then clear the lock flag in the console. If the console itself refuses your session, you'll need the recovery passphrase, which is kept right below for the rotation.

vault phrase of tajef-tafog = istox-sorax-zorox-casok-holox-kelix-weneth-drueth-casion

CI note: the Ladlemath recipe-scaling calculator job keeps timing out on the fraction-rounding tests. It's not your change — the runner image got slower after last week's base bump. Bumping the test timeout to 90s fixes it; a proper fix is caching the unit tables. Safe to re-trigger. The stuck run corresponds to the build token below.

pipeline stamp: htk3_69f